UltraEdit ist ein mächtiger Texteditor, der bei Programmierern und Entwicklern weltweit sehr beliebt ist. Mit seinen zahlreichen Funktionen und Anpassungsmöglichkeiten bietet er eine ideale Umgebung für die effiziente Bearbeitung von Code. Eine Herausforderung, die jedoch häufig auftritt, sind störende Leerzeichen. Diese können die Lesbarkeit des Codes beeinträchtigen und die Fehlersuche erschweren. Glücklicherweise bietet UltraEdit eine einfache Möglichkeit, diese unerwünschten Zeichen auszublenden, sodass Sie sich voll und ganz auf Ihren Code konzentrieren können.
Warum sind störende Leerzeichen ein Problem?
Bevor wir uns der Lösung zuwenden, ist es wichtig zu verstehen, warum störende Leerzeichen überhaupt ein Problem darstellen. Hier sind einige Gründe:
- Lesbarkeit: Übermäßige oder inkonsistente Leerzeichen können den Code schwer lesbar machen. Dies gilt insbesondere für Sprachen, die stark von Einrückungen abhängig sind, wie beispielsweise Python.
- Fehlersuche: In manchen Fällen können unsichtbare Leerzeichen, wie beispielsweise Tabulatoren oder Leerzeichen am Zeilenende, zu unerwartetem Verhalten des Programms führen und die Fehlersuche erheblich erschweren.
- Code-Konsistenz: In einem Team ist es wichtig, einheitliche Codierstandards einzuhalten. Inkonsistente Leerzeichen können zu unnötigen Code-Reviews und Konflikten führen.
- Visuelle Ablenkung: Selbst wenn Leerzeichen die Funktionalität des Codes nicht beeinträchtigen, können sie visuell ablenken und die Konzentration auf die wesentlichen Aspekte des Codes erschweren.
UltraEdit: Die Lösung für störende Leerzeichen
UltraEdit bietet eine elegante Lösung, um störende Leerzeichen auszublenden. Anstatt die Leerzeichen tatsächlich zu entfernen, was den Code verändern würde, bietet UltraEdit die Möglichkeit, diese visuell auszublenden, sodass sie beim Lesen und Bearbeiten des Codes nicht mehr stören. Hier ist eine Schritt-für-Schritt-Anleitung, wie Sie diese Funktion aktivieren:
Schritt 1: Zugriff auf die Konfiguration
Der erste Schritt besteht darin, die Konfigurationseinstellungen von UltraEdit zu öffnen. Dies können Sie auf zwei Arten erreichen:
- Über das Menü: Klicken Sie auf das Menü „Erweitert” und wählen Sie dann „Einstellungen…”.
- Über die Tastenkombination: Drücken Sie die Tastenkombination `Strg + U`.
Beide Methoden führen zum gleichen Ergebnis: das Öffnen des Konfigurationsdialogs.
Schritt 2: Navigation zu den Editor-Anzeigeeinstellungen
Im Konfigurationsdialog finden Sie eine Vielzahl von Optionen. Um die relevanten Einstellungen für das Ausblenden von Leerzeichen zu finden, navigieren Sie zu folgendem Pfad:
„Editor-Anzeige” -> „Anzeige”
In diesem Bereich finden Sie verschiedene Optionen, die die visuelle Darstellung des Editors beeinflussen.
Schritt 3: Die Option „Leerzeichen/Tabulatoren anzeigen” deaktivieren
In den Anzeigeoptionen suchen Sie nach der Option „Leerzeichen/Tabulatoren anzeigen” oder einer ähnlichen Formulierung. Diese Option ist standardmäßig aktiviert, was bedeutet, dass UltraEdit Leerzeichen und Tabulatoren als kleine Punkte bzw. Pfeile anzeigt. Um störende Leerzeichen auszublenden, müssen Sie diese Option deaktivieren. Entfernen Sie einfach das Häkchen aus dem Kontrollkästchen neben der Option.
Schritt 4: Anwendung der Änderungen
Nachdem Sie die Option „Leerzeichen/Tabulatoren anzeigen” deaktiviert haben, klicken Sie auf die Schaltfläche „Übernehmen” oder „OK”, um die Änderungen zu speichern und den Konfigurationsdialog zu schließen. UltraEdit wird nun die neuen Einstellungen übernehmen.
Ergebnis: Saubere Code-Ansicht
Nachdem Sie die oben genannten Schritte ausgeführt haben, sollten Sie feststellen, dass die störenden Leerzeichen (Punkte und Pfeile) in Ihrem Code ausgeblendet sind. Ihr Code sollte nun sauberer und übersichtlicher aussehen, sodass Sie sich besser auf die eigentliche Logik konzentrieren können.
Weitere nützliche Einstellungen für eine optimale Code-Darstellung
Neben dem Ausblenden von Leerzeichen bietet UltraEdit noch weitere Einstellungen, die die Code-Darstellung optimieren und die Arbeit erleichtern können. Hier sind einige Beispiele:
- Syntaxhervorhebung: UltraEdit unterstützt Syntaxhervorhebung für eine Vielzahl von Programmiersprachen. Diese Funktion hebt Schlüsselwörter, Kommentare, Variablen und andere Code-Elemente in unterschiedlichen Farben hervor, was die Lesbarkeit und das Verständnis des Codes erheblich verbessert. Die Syntaxhervorhebung kann in den „Editor-Anzeige” Einstellungen konfiguriert werden.
- Automatische Einrückung: Die automatische Einrückung sorgt dafür, dass Ihr Code korrekt eingerückt wird, was die Lesbarkeit und Wartbarkeit erhöht. Diese Funktion kann in den „Editor” Einstellungen aktiviert und konfiguriert werden.
- Zeilennummern anzeigen: Die Anzeige von Zeilennummern ist besonders hilfreich bei der Fehlersuche, da Fehlermeldungen oft auf bestimmte Zeilen verweisen. Die Zeilennummern können in den „Editor-Anzeige” -> „Ansicht” Einstellungen aktiviert werden.
- Minimap: Die Minimap ist eine kleine Übersichtsdarstellung des gesamten Codes, die am rechten Rand des Editors angezeigt wird. Sie ermöglicht eine schnelle Navigation durch lange Dateien. Die Minimap kann in den „Editor-Anzeige” -> „Ansicht” Einstellungen aktiviert werden.
Tipps und Tricks für den Umgang mit Leerzeichen in UltraEdit
Obwohl das Ausblenden von Leerzeichen eine effektive Methode ist, um die Code-Darstellung zu verbessern, gibt es auch Situationen, in denen es sinnvoll sein kann, Leerzeichen anzuzeigen. Hier sind einige Tipps und Tricks für den Umgang mit Leerzeichen in UltraEdit:
- Selektives Anzeigen von Leerzeichen: Anstatt alle Leerzeichen auszublenden, können Sie UltraEdit so konfigurieren, dass nur bestimmte Arten von Leerzeichen angezeigt werden. Beispielsweise können Sie Tabulatoren ausblenden, aber Leerzeichen anzeigen, oder umgekehrt. Dies kann hilfreich sein, um Inkonsistenzen in der Einrückung zu erkennen.
- Suchen und Ersetzen von Leerzeichen: UltraEdit bietet eine leistungsstarke Such- und Ersetzen-Funktion, mit der Sie Leerzeichen suchen und durch andere Zeichen ersetzen können. Dies kann nützlich sein, um beispielsweise alle Tabulatoren in Leerzeichen umzuwandeln oder Leerzeichen am Zeilenende zu entfernen.
- Regular Expressions: Für komplexere Such- und Ersetzungsoperationen können Sie Regular Expressions verwenden. Mit Regular Expressions können Sie Muster definieren, die bestimmte Arten von Leerzeichen oder Leerzeichenmuster erkennen.
- Code-Formatierungstools: Für viele Programmiersprachen gibt es Code-Formatierungstools, die den Code automatisch formatieren und Leerzeichen gemäß den Codierstandards anpassen. Die Integration solcher Tools in UltraEdit kann die Code-Qualität und -Konsistenz verbessern.
Fazit
UltraEdit ist ein vielseitiger Texteditor, der Programmierern und Entwicklern eine Vielzahl von Funktionen bietet, um effizienter zu arbeiten. Das Ausblenden von störenden Leerzeichen ist eine einfache, aber effektive Möglichkeit, die Lesbarkeit und Übersichtlichkeit des Codes zu verbessern. Indem Sie die oben genannten Schritte befolgen und die zusätzlichen Tipps und Tricks anwenden, können Sie UltraEdit optimal nutzen und sich voll und ganz auf die Entwicklung hochwertiger Software konzentrieren. Die Fähigkeit, zwischen dem Anzeigen und Ausblenden von unsichtbaren Zeichen zu wechseln, gibt Ihnen die Flexibilität, Ihren Code so anzuzeigen, wie es für die jeweilige Aufgabe am besten ist. Ob Sie nun Fehler beheben, Code reviewen oder einfach nur sauberen, übersichtlichen Code schreiben möchten, UltraEdit hat die Werkzeuge, die Sie dafür benötigen.